in their Winter feathers -
at least a dozen in this flock of Gold Finches -
the Summer feathers of the males are a bright yellow -
with black wings, tail and head -
when spotted on a Dandelion -
it blends so well with the yellow, that if the Gold Finch moves -
then you can spot it -
some House Finches -
and Juncos -
a Blue Jay and Northern Cardinal -
but this was a Gold Finch Meeting -
a busy morning -
weather is getting colder -
saw several constantly fluffing their feathers to trap in heat -
